Transaction dab963cd7adcf6e190108cc81ba46d87dfde5ad530e416d863808407bf995966
1 Input
1 Output
-
dab963cd7adcf6e190108cc81ba46d87dfde5ad530e416d863808407bf995966:0
- value
- 12403131
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1967d300017cede826014dfef0e01f4faa33292a OP_EQUALVERIFY OP_CHECKSIG
- address
- 13KLGdUoAFn3g3JKN74ihMFWfYwejgvrri